Output 095d66202a132d274ab532572b9e2527768c25da25036edb7303277f6dda3f0d:0

value
37974452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97eb7a4974c9fa8a7ec394a2358c245236692e1 OP_EQUAL
address
3QSDynXRGiLsFVco9z89LE9ZwxbR3W9sz3
transaction
095d66202a132d274ab532572b9e2527768c25da25036edb7303277f6dda3f0d
spent
true